
*{box-sizing: border-box;}

/* hide spinner for type="number" inputs */
input::-webkit-outer-spin-button,
input::-webkit-inner-spin-button {
    -webkit-appearance: none;
    margin: 0; 
}

.oCLIP
{
  white-space: nowrap;
  overflow: hidden;
  text-overflow: ellipsis;
  max-width: 400px;
}

.cL
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-decoration:none;
  color:#009999;
}
.cL:hover
{
  color:#996600;
  text-decoration:underline;
}

.dtL
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-decoration:none;
  color:#009999;
}
.dtL:hover
{
  color:#996600;
  text-decoration:underline;
}

.coL
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-decoration:none;
  color:#009999;
}
.coL:hover
{
  color:#996600;
  text-decoration:underline;
}

.cE
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-decoration:none;
  color:#000000;
}

.cE:hover
{
  color:#000000;
  text-decoration:underline;
}

.cPB
{
  height:12px;
  background-color:#009999;
}

.cP
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-decoration:none;
  color:#000000;
}

.cD
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:10px;
  line-height:13px;
  text-decoration:none;
  color:#333333;
}

.cB 
{
  margin-top:5px; 
  margin-left:5px; 
  margin-right:5px; 
  margin-bottom:5px; 
  background-color:#ffaaaa;
}

.cT
{
  width:100%;
}

.cR
{
  width:100%; 
}

.cW
{
  color:#cc0000;
  border-style: none;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cC
{
  background-color:#ffcccc; 
  border-style:solid; 
  border-color:#ffffff;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:15px;
} 

.cCF
{
  background-color:#ffcccc; 
  border-style:solid; 
  border-color:#000000;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:15px;
} 

.cCL
{
  color:#000000;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-decoration:none;
} 
.cCL:hover
{
  color:#000000;
  text-decoration:underline;
}


.cH
{
  font-family:Verdana, Arial, Sans-Serif;
  color:#ffffff;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cU
{
  font-family:Verdana, Arial, Sans-Serif;
  color:#333333;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cCT
{
  background-color:#ff8888;
  color:#ffffff;
  border-style:solid; 
  border-color:#666666;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cCH
{
  background-color:#009999;
  color:#ffffff;
  border-style:solid; 
  border-color:#666666;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cCB
{
  background-color:#ffaaaa;
  color:#ffffff;
  border-style:solid; 
  border-color:#666666;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cCW
{
  background-color:#cccccc;
  color:#cc0000;
  border-style:solid; 
  border-color:#cc0000;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:12px;
  font-weight:bold;
  line-height:15px;
} 

.cCE
{
  background-color:#cccccc;
  color:#660000;
  border-style:solid; 
  border-color:#cc0000;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-size:10px;
  font-weight:bold;
  line-height:12px;
} 

.cCS
{
  color:#ffffff;
  font-family:Verdana, Arial, Sans-Serif;
  font-weight:normal;
  font-style:italic;
  font-size:12px;
  text-decoration:none;
} 
.cCS:hover
{
  color:#ffffff;
  text-decoration:underline;
}


.cCI
{
  background-color:#ffcccc; 
  border-style:solid; 
  border-color:#ffffff; 
  border-width:1px;
  font-family:Verdana, Arial, Sans-Serif;
  font-weight:normal;
  font-style:italic;
  font-size:10px;
} 

.sH
{
  background-color:#ffcccc; 
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  font-weight:bold;
  line-height:13px;
  text-align:center;
} 

.sT
{
  background-color:#ffcccc; 
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  font-weight:bold;
  line-height:13px;
  text-align:right;
} 

.sE
{
  background-color:#ffcccc; 
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  line-height:13px;
  text-align:left;
} 

.sS
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
} 

.sSM
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:11px;
  width:300px;
} 

.t
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:1px;
  line-height:1px;
} 

.s
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:10px;
  font-weight:normal;
} 

.sM
{
  font-family:Verdana, Arial, Sans-Serif;
  font-size:9px;
  font-weight:normal;
} 

.cM
{
  position:absolute;
} 

.cCAD
{
  position:absolute;
  overflow: hidden; 
  overflow-y:auto;
  -webkit-overflow-scrolling: touch;  
  border-top-color:#999999;
  border-top-style:solid; 
  border-top-width:2px;
  top: 62px;
  bottom: 0;
  left: 0;
  right: 0;
  padding-left:5px;
  padding-right:5px;
  padding-top:5px;
}

.cVH
{
  width:1px;
  border-left-style:solid; 
  border-left-color:#009999;
  border-left-width:2px;
}

.cVB
{
  width:1px;
  border-left-style:none;
  border-left-width:2px;
}

#tinymce
{
  font-size: 12px;
}
